BMIC’s Four-Layer Architecture Prepared for the Quantum Era
BMIC says it is preparing for the future by developing a holistic solution to address the challenges of quantum security, centralized compute control, and the growing demand for AI processing power. It’s built around a quantum-resistant crypto wallet, topped with an arsenal of security services, decentralized compute access, blockchain governance, and AI capabilities.
It offers four security layers designed to evolve with technology while ensuring all your digital assets are SAFE and sound. Here’s a quick overview of BMCI’s system:
- Layer 1 – A quantum-resistant wallet built using post-quantum cryptography (PQC), allowing users to prepare for the future instead of facing costly migrations.
- Layer 2 – The quantum hardware layer, AKA the Meta-Cloud, a system that provides a unified access layer connecting multiple hardware providers into a decentralized network. It features global connectivity, enterprise-level security solutions, in a transparent ecosystem.
- Layer 3 – Blockchain access layer based on trust, transparency, and incentives for BMIC token holders. They include payments, staking, a burn-to-compute model, and governance rights.
- Layer 4 – AI optimization layer that connects all three previous layers, analyzing all data to optimize performance, detect threats, update cryptography, and more.
These four layers work together to ensure hackers, criminals, malware, and all other potential threats don’t find their way to users’ keys, digital assets, data, and other sensitive information.
BMIC Provides Utility
The BMIC tokens provide utility through payments, access to wallet services, enterprise security, and compute, its creators say. They are required to access the ecosystem and all its features, and a portion is distributed through staking rewards.
Furthermore, users can burn their tokens to generate BMIC compute credits (BCC), which are used to run quantum workloads. In turn, this will reduce the token supply, creating potentially long-term scarcity.
The ecosystem has a fixed supply of 1.5 billion BMIC tokens (capped, ensuring scarcity). Strategic allocation is as follows: presale 50%, private sale 10%, rewards and staking 12%, liquidity and exchanges 10%, ecosystem reserve 9%, marketing 6%, and team 3%.
